Burnt Store Lakes residents enjoy public water and sewer, a Community Park which has covered picnic benches, a playground and restrooms. There is a kayak ramp for Residents only, that accesses Charlotte Harbor and the incredible wildlife in the Charlotte Harbor Aquatic Preserve such as Manatees, porpoises, sea turtles and an abundance of game fish. Next door at Burnt Store Marina, SW Florida’s full-service deep-water marina, restaurants are open to the public and amenities such as golf and boat dockage may be available.
